Jive Forums

We have a prototype replacement ready for our newsgroups, using Jive Forums.

We have chosen Jive as our new discussion forums server for several reasons:

  • Jive supports both NNTP (we also added support for simultaneous NNTPS) and HTTP/HTTPS discussion forums that use the same messagebase, so there are no synchronization or latency issues between the two interfaces.
  • It has a very rich set of browser options we liked.
  • It is written in Java and maintainable with JBuilder
  • It is similar to OpenFire, which used for our Chat system. This made the support for single sign-on with CodeGear membership services easier.

Customizations

Our Jive customizations include:
  • Single sign-on using CodeGear membership services
  • Our Embarcadero look and feel
  • Ability to display an unlimited depth forum hierarchy on the main page
  • Expanding and collapsing of forum hierarchy on the home page
  • Support for BlackfishSQL as the database
  • Very fast batch creation based on a text file import for many forums and newsgroups at the same time with a special tool we cleverly named ForumPort
  • Support for both NNTPS (for private) and NNTP (for public) newsgroups. NNTPS logins are only allowed for people who have private access. NNTPS users can participate in both the private and public groups with a single newsgroup account. Only the groups to which they have access show up in their newsgroup list. NNTP users can participate in all public forums, but must be logged in to post any content.
  • We will deploy Gravatar Support in addition to Jive's standard avatars, which are turned on for http clients. See Developer Network Avatar Support for more information.
  • UI integration with our Chat system on the browser-based discussion forum pages.
  • Lots of NNTP bug fixes.
  • Additional NNTP headers that can be used by NNTP readers to integrate with the browser-based forums

Testing

Our server implements single sign-on. You must have a CodeGear membership services account to post content. Our public discussion forums can be read without logging in, but posting content requires a valid login.

Feedback is welcome here or on the Developer Network Website forum.

Browser interface

If you are called a "Guest" in the browser interface, you will not be able to post content. All other functionality should be supported for the public groups.

https://forums.codegear.com is the main page URL for the browser-based discussion forums.

Public newsgroups via NNTP

If you want to post messages, you must configure your newsgroup reader for the following settings:
  • this server requires me to login, and provide your CodeGear membership services login name and password to login. (If you don't remember your login name, go to https://members.codegear.com. On the login form, the first value is your login name. If no values are displayed, it means your USER cookie is not currently set. In that case, login with your email address, and click on Edit my account information. Your login name will be dispayed above your first name.)
  • always authenticate

news://forums.codegear.com will give you access to all public groups defined on the server. These correspond to the browser-based discussion forums. Messages posted via nntp are visible via the browser client, and vice versa.

Private and public newsgroups via NNTPS

If you want to read the private newsgroups to which you have access, and post messages either to the private or public groups, you must configure your newsgroup reader for the following settings:
  • this server requires me to login, and provide your CodeGear membership services login name and password to login
  • always authenticate
  • use SSL

Note! Any user may choose to login with an SSL connection. The SSL communication is slightly slower due to encryption/decryption of the NNTP packets, but most users won't notice the performance difference. This is a more secure connection for your account login information.

You can use the news://forums.codegear.com hyperlink, but you will need to customize your account settings as described above to get access to all your private groups, and to all public groups. There is no need for a second account to participate in public group discussions.

Outlook Express

Steps to configure Outlook Express are courtesy of Angus Johnson.
  1. In Outlook Express, via the following menu items - Tools | Accounts | Add | News ...
  2. Display Name = ("Name" in CodeGear Account Profile) -> Next
  3. Email Address = (Seems to accept any address) -> Next
  4. News Server = forums.codegear.com
  5. Check "My news server requires me to log on" -> Next
  6. Account Name = ("Username" in CodeGear Account Profile)
  7. Password = (CodeGear Account password)
  8. Leave "Remember Password" checked
  9. Leave "Log on using Secure Password Authentication" unchecked
  10. Next -> Finished -> Close

Thunderbird

These steps are courtesy of TeamB member Rudy Velthuis.
  1. Tools -> Account Settings... -> Add Account
  2. (*) Newsgroup Account -> Next
  3. Enter your name and your email address -> Next
  4. forums.codegear.com -> Next
  5. Enter a display name for the server -> Next
  6. -> Finish
  7. In the account settings dialog, go to the newly created entry, and select Server Settings. Check the always request authentication... checkbox. -> OK
  8. Select the new server in the treeview at the left, and choose Manage Newsgroup Subscriptions on the right.
  9. Answer the questions for username and password. Then, after a few seconds, you should see a tree of all the newsgroups. Select the ones you are interested in, and now you can read them, and write to them.

XanaNews

XanaNews supports multiple accounts being set up for the same server. This section describes access for our public forums and for our private forums.

Note: XanaNews 1.19.1.11 has added support for some of our custom NNTP headers. Those of you who use XanaNews may want to upgrade.

Configuring public forums only

For users who only have access to our public groups, the best performance is available by not using SSL. The following instructions are for XanaNews 1.18.1.52:
  1. Account -> Add New Account ...
  2. Enter the account name -> Next
  3. Enter forums.codegear.com as the server name
  4. Check This server requires me to logon and fill in the User Name, Password, and Retype Password fields -> Next
  5. On the Finished dialog -> OK
  6. Right mouse click on the newly created account in the tree view and select Account Properties
  7. Click Server Settings and check Always authenticate
  8. Click OK

You should now be able to retrieve your newsgroup list, subscribe, and start joining the discussion in the public groups.

Configuring both public and private forums

The configuration for both public and private is nearly identical to public only. The only difference is SSL support needs to be added after the New Account wizard completes.
  1. Account -> Add New Account ...
  2. Enter the account name -> Next
  3. Enter forums.codegear.com as the server name
  4. Check This server requires me to logon and fill in the User Name, Password, and Retype Password fields -> Next
  5. On the Finished dialog -> OK
  6. Right mouse click on the newly created account in the tree view and select Account Properties
  7. Select Server Settings and check Always authenticate
  8. Select Diallup[sic] & Connection and check SSL Required
  9. Click OK

You should now be able to retrieve your newsgroup list, subscribe, and start joining the discussion in both the private and public groups.
